PANews reports on April 2nd that, according to Cointelegraph, six digital economy industry associations in the UK recently jointly wrote a letter to Prime Minister Keir Starmer's office, calling on the country's government to appoint a cryptocurrency envoy and develop a specialized digital asset development plan. The letter, submitted on March 31st, was directly delivered to the Prime Minister's Special Advisor for Business and Investment, Varun Chandra, emphasizing that the UK urgently needs to "strengthen strategic focus" to promote investment, employment, and economic growth in the crypto field.

The alliance members include the UK Crypto Asset Business Council, Global Digital Finance Association, Payments Association, Digital Currency Governance Group, Crypto Innovation Council, and Tech UK Association.
